Lanterns became symbolic decorations welcoming the month of Ramadan. Within a growing amount of nations, They can be hung on town streets.[51][52][fifty three] The tradition of lanterns being a decoration turning out to be connected with Ramadan is considered to own originated through the Fatimid Caliphate mostly centered in Egypt, in which Caliph al-Mu'izz li-Din Allah was greeted by people holding lanterns to celebrate his ruling.

As there isn't any solitary Islamic authority in Burma to produce Formal selections on moon-sighting, it is sometimes hard to get to consensus on the start and end of Ramadan. This normally leads to Eid remaining celebrated on different days in modest towns and villages.

Among the most important trials of Abraham's everyday living was to experience the command of God to sacrifice his dearest possession, his son.[five] The son is just not named within the Quran, but Muslims believe that it to get Ishmael, whereas it truly is pointed out as Isaac from the Bible. Upon Listening to this command, Abraham prepared to submit to will of God.

In Turkey, nationwide celebrated holidays are generally known as bayram, and Eid al-Fitr is referred to as both of those Şeker Bayramı ("Bayram of Sweets") and Ramazan Bayramı ("Ramadan Bayram"). It is a public holiday, wherever faculties and federal government workplaces are usually closed for the whole 3-working day period of the celebrations. The celebrations of this bayram are infused with countrywide traditions. It is customary for people to greet one another with Bayramınız kutlu olsun ("Could your bayram be blessed"[20]) or Bayramınız mübarek olsun ("May your bayram be blessed"). Mutlu Bayramlar ("Pleased Bayram") is an alternative phrase for celebrating this bayram. It's really a time for people today to attend prayer services, place on their own most effective apparel (called bayramlık, usually ordered only for the celebration), pay a visit to all their family and friends (such as kin, neighbours, and buddies), and shell out their respects to the deceased with organised visits to cemeteries, where substantial, momentary bazaars of bouquets, water (for watering the crops adorning a grave), and prayer publications are setup for your 3-day event.

Due to the fact 2012, Tunisia sees three days of celebration, with only 2 days for a national holiday break (1st Eid and second Eid), with preparations commencing a number of days earlier. Specific biscuits are made to offer to mates and relations to the day, which include Baklawa and several varieties of "ka'ak". Men will go to the mosque early each morning, although the Females will both go with them or stay in and prepare for that celebration by putting jointly new outfits and toys for his or her youngsters, as well as a major household lunch usually held at one of many moms and dads' properties.
